About the role: Smyths Toys is one of the world's largest specialty retailers of children's toys. We operate both online and via our physical retail stores, with hundreds of stores spread across Europe and the UK. We’re looking for a Regional HR Officer based in London / Essex / South East, with solid knowledge and generalist experience in HR-related activities, practices and policies to look after our Northern Irish and Dublin stores.

You will utilise your deep generalist HR knowledge and HR systems acumen to provide consultative guidance to our line managers, enabling them to build high-performing teams and maintain rigorous compliance in a fast-paced, evolving retail landscape. A proven track record of coaching and influencing managers is essential. You’ll also be a self-starter with a tenacious and delivery-focused approach. Flexibility with travel, your own car and a full driving license is also a must, as you’ll be visiting stores spread across fairly large geographical areas and overnight stays will be required. Salary banding - £30,000 to £40,000 per annum.

Responsibilities / duties include:

  • Strategic Collaboration: Act as a trusted consultant, collaborating closely with line managers to deliver sound, legally compliant HR advice, empowering them to manage their teams effectively.
  • HR Systems & Data Integrity: Manage and optimise HR systems, trackers, and databases, ensuring data accuracy and leveraging system capabilities to provide meaningful insights and streamline HR processes.
  • Compliance & Auditing: Drive high standards of people management by conducting comprehensive HR audits within UK stores and overseeing meticulous compliance with absence management and other critical HR criteria.
  • Employee Relations Expertise: Lead and manage complex employee relations cases, including attending and advising on investigation, disciplinary, and grievance meetings.
  • Lifecycle Management Support: Provide expert management support for key employee lifecycle processes, including maternity leave and flexible working applications.
  • Talent Acquisition Support: Partner with the business to assist with recruitment efforts across all functional areas.
  • Central Resource: Serve as the primary, reliable point of contact for managers and all employees across the region.

Person specification: Successful candidates would have experience in a HR Advisor / Officer position. Good ER knowledge. Achieved or working toward CIPD qualification is desirable. Strong interpersonal and consulting skills. Be able to work with large volumes of work and support cases. Be flexible with regards to travel and overnight stays. Full UK driving license.

Benefits: An attractive competitive salary. A benefits package inclusive of: 7.5% matched pension, 31 days annual leave rising with length of service, Defined Contribution Pension Scheme, Life Assurance Cover, Employee Assistance Programme, In-store discount, High street discounts, Enhanced Maternity and Paternity Payments, Special Life-Event Gifts, Length of Service Awards.
